Nurse-Family Partnership® is free for women who are pregnant with their first baby. When you enroll you will be connected to a registered nurse who will provide the support, advice and information you need to have a health pregnancy, a health baby and be a great mom. Visits take place starting in your pregnancy and continue for as long as you need after your baby is born (up to 2 years). Your nurse is there to follow your dreams and desires through a new, exciting, and scary time of becoming a parent.
Available to any woman who is pregnant with her first child, meets income requirements, and lives in one of the 6 counties in our service area. The mother must enroll before 29 weeks pregnant.
